Output 8382a35098da5b4f0034b77c31331bfcf7804c8a53bf6c1a67b23d0a15724fa0:1

value
1646000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8608bc9b13d0c155d92c094907feae987a6ae0f1 OP_EQUAL
address
3DuiwHgd86FVoQNFG1srVCTDMEEc1dn78w
transaction
8382a35098da5b4f0034b77c31331bfcf7804c8a53bf6c1a67b23d0a15724fa0
spent
true